If you don't mind being with other people, you can try looking up a local hostel. I've never done it here in the states but they're really popular and affordable in latin america and europe. There's a website Hosteling International and you can find reputable places on there, HI-Houston: The Morty Rich Hostel seems like it has good google reviews. ~$25 per night for a bed in a dorm, $65 per night for a private room.
